#e79729 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e79729 is composed of 90.6% red, 59.2% green and 16.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 34.6% magenta, 82.3%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 34.7 degrees, a saturation of 79.8% and a lightness of 53.3%. #e79729 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ff52 with #cf2f00. Closest websafe color is: #ff9933.

#e79729 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e79729 has RGB values of R:231, G:151, B:41 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.35, Y:0.82,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 15177513.
